Output c62e53085fc7684bfa037bc2492a49fc36f63cbff0af646d90c24e7359072316:0

value
3580349196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0a83b9639cd1dcbee31ce7476acaaae72022f8d OP_EQUAL
address
3KFhCPi8D7YaDNL9Jqxta84kWmBzTQwuW3
transaction
c62e53085fc7684bfa037bc2492a49fc36f63cbff0af646d90c24e7359072316
spent
true